KMScript.com DIGITIZED as KMScript
- 概念
- 日志保留了运行状态、产生的异常
- 日志文件扩展名 .log
- 文件内容为纯文本,编码 UTF-8,换行符为 \n
- 文件名始终为 月份中的当天数.log,例如今天20号则日志在 20.log
- 文件始终保存31份
- 文件每天覆盖上个月的今天
- 每个文件最大100M,超过会被清空提供重新写入
- 文件可在登录后点击菜单 "系统日志" 查阅
- 文件均位于 release/FMS/log/ 目录下
- 不推荐向非有关人士发送日志,可能包含隐私信息,例如文件读取异常时可能记录了文件路径
- 内容格式
- 由3部分组成,例如 "2 11:22:33 hello" 其从左边开始各部份分别为
- 等级编号,分别是
- 2 表示为发布信息,是最高等级,这往往是一些关键信息需要用户知道。例如服务已启动
- 4 表示为错误信息,运行过程中发生的错误均以此等级起始
- 6 表示为警告信息,运行过程中发生可忽略的意外以此等级起始,也被用于记录必要的备用信息。例如用户A从 a.b.c.d 登录系统
- 8 表示为调试信息,该信息通常为开发者用于跟踪运行状态而输出的无关信息。例如图像已成功捕获
- 9 表示为细节信息,该信息默认为关闭状态(出厂即被移除),记录了核心开发者需要的上下文细节数据。例如显卡的xx区yy值已变动
- 时间,格式是时分秒。日期即文件名本身
- 日志信息,为个组件输出的内容
- 默认等级可在 release/libjp.conf 的配置文件里 dlogger 一节设置,约定出厂时为6
骨骼配置:ui,值:li_tag